World in Progress: The fallout from Russia's war on Ukraine

March 23, 2022

In addition to the toll the fighting has taken on people in Ukraine, the UN and aid organizations have started sounding the alarm about how Russia's war will affect world hunger — Ukraine and Russia are two of the world's top crop producers. DW speaks to Martin Rentsch who works for the UN's World Food Program in Berlin. How bad is the humanitarian situation in Ukraine right now?

War and conflict, COVID-19, climate shocks, rising prices will push millions of people closer to starvation. A total of 44 million people in 38 countries are already on the brink of famine and global needs for humanitarian assistance are higher than ever.  

Cities like Mariupol and Kyiv are under shelling which makes it virtually impossible to deliver much needed food aid to residents.
